Probably the most important factor in you carpet quality choice is going to be the cost because, like the old saying goes, you get what you pay for and this definitely applies to carpet purchases. The highest quality materials with the longest wear and easiest maintenance are going to be the most expensive to buy but the least expensive to own over the years.
The carpets with the lesser quality materials and construction will be cheaper to purchase initially but will be more difficult to maintain and will have to be completely replaced sooner. They will be more expensive to maintain because they will be more likely to not resist stains well and will not stand up to vigorous cleaning like the higher quality carpets.
You will usually find it easier when beginning your carpet color selection to move toward your final decision slowly by starting with the most basic color options first and gradually making your way through the color spectrum toward a tone that suits you best.
Begin you color selection by looking at the room you will be installing the carpet in. If the room walls are dark you will want to choose a lighter shade of carpet. If the walls in the room are light, go with a darker shade for your floor. Once you have decided on whether to go with light or dark carpet you then just need to start working your way slowly through the color spectrum to find the perfect hue for the room.
